Uniform depth channel flow keeps fluid depth consistent along channels such as irrigation canals. In natural channels, such as rivers, approximate uniform flow is often assumed. This condition occurs when the channel’s bottom slope matches the energy slope, balancing potential energy lost from gravity with head loss due to shear stress. 基于部分独立生成模型和复杂差异稀疏性约束的无监督4D流MRI重建

Zhongsen Li1, Aiqi Sun2, Haining Wei1

  • 1School of Biomedical Engineering, Tsinghua University, Beijing, China.

Medical image analysis
|August 27, 2025
PubMed
概括

这项研究引入了一种无监督的深度学习方法,用于重建4D流MRI (四维流磁共振成像) 数据,克服了改善血管成像诊断的监督方法的局限性.

科学领域:

  • 医学成像
  • 生物物理
  • 机器学习

背景情况:

  • 4D流MRI为诊断血管疾病提供了重要的时空血流速度量化.
  • 由于数据大小,需要重建算法,因此需要低采样4D流MRI.
  • 现有的监督深度学习方法面临有限的培训数据和概括性的挑战.

研究的目的:

  • 开发一个无监督的深度学习方法来进行4D流MRI重建.
  • 解决监督方法在数据可用性和通用性方面的局限性.
  • 提高4D流MRI重建的准确性和效率.

主要方法:

  • 提出了基于深度图像先前框架的无监督重建方法.
  • 设计了一个部分独立的网络,以提高参数效率和缩小模型大小.
  • 整合复杂差异稀疏性约束以实现精确的相位恢复.
  • 使用"预训练+ADMM微调"算法的联合生成和稀疏优化目标.

主要成果:

  • 与压缩传感和监督深度学习方法相比,证明了优异的重建性能.
  • 在不同血管数据集 (大动脉和大脑) 中展示了增强的概括能力.
  • 验证了拟议的网络架构和优化战略的有效性.

结论:

  • 无监督深度学习方法为4D流MRI重建提供了强大的解决方案.
  • 该方法有效地克服了数据的局限性,并改善了对各种血管应用的概括性.
  • 这项技术有望在使用4D流MRI的血管疾病中提高诊断能力.
